To use Apple Pay without a physical card, first, ensure your bank supports Apple Pay. Open the Wallet app on your iPhone, tap the '+' symbol, and follow the prompts to add your bank account, debit, or credit card details directly. If you don’t have a card, some banks allow you to create a virtual card within their app or online banking platform, which you can then add to Apple Pay. This way, you can enjoy contactless payments solely through your device, making transactions both convenient and secure.
FAQs & Answers
- Can I use Apple Pay without a physical debit or credit card? Yes, you can use Apple Pay without a physical card by adding a virtual card or bank account details directly through the Wallet app if your bank supports this feature.
- How do I add a virtual card to Apple Pay? You need to create a virtual card through your bank's app or online banking, then open the Wallet app on your iPhone, tap the '+', and follow the prompts to add it to Apple Pay.
- Does every bank support using Apple Pay without a physical card? No, not all banks offer virtual cards or allow adding bank accounts without physical cards for Apple Pay, so check with your bank for compatibility.
